BURKEY v. DEEDS

No. CV-S-92-590-LDG-(RJJ).

824 F.Supp. 190 (1993)

Kenneth H. BURKEY, Petitioner, v. George DEEDS, Warden, Southern Desert Correctional Center and The Attorney General of the State of Nevada, Respondents.

United States District Court, D. Nevada.

June 1, 1993.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Kenneth H. Burkey, in pro per.

Paul S. Lychuk, Deputy Atty. Gen., Crim. Justice Div., Las Vegas NV, for respondents.


ORDER

GEORGE, Chief Judge.

This matter is before the court on Respondents' Motion to Dismiss Petition for Writ of Habeas Corpus (# 6). Petitioner Opposed (# 7) and Magistrate Judge Johnston submitted a Report & Recommendation (# 8) recommending a grant of the motion to dismiss. Petitioner filed a timely Objection (# 9).
